As of this sprint, all telemetry payloads from the Corvid agents are zstd-compressed before ingest. The decompressor runs in the Strobeline edge tier. If the edge tier fails closed and payloads back up, break-glass access lets on-call bypass compression and write raw payloads to the overflow bucket. Bypass requires two approvals in normal hours; after hours, one on-call plus the break-glass credential suffices. Log every use in the sync notes. The break-glass passphrase for the overflow path is:

vault phrase of bagaf-kajeg = jorath-feniel-briir-siliel-ralix

- [ ] Vendored fonts check (Brindlework key ceremony). Before we seal the ceremony bundle, confirm all third-party fonts in `vendor/type/` are pinned by checksum and none are pulled at build time — yes, even the fancy display face Marisol added for the cert viewer. If a fetch sneaks in, the ceremony artifacts won't reproduce and we redo the whole afternoon. Once you've ticked this off and the bundle hashes match, unlock the staging keystore with the passphrase below.

vault phrase of taweg-kafof = oliax-zorael

Subject: Partner SFTP drop — new owner

Hi,

As you review the pending changes to the Harborline ingest scripts, note that ownership of the partner SFTP drop is changing at the end of the month. This includes key rotation, the nightly pull job, and the quarantine folder for malformed files. Review comments on the retry logic should still go through the normal PR flow, but questions about drop-folder conventions or partner onboarding now go to the new owner. The incoming owner is listed below.

signatory, tagaf-bahaf: Praael Fenmir Rusok

## Account Recovery — Trailnote Offline Mode

When a surveyor's Trailnote app has been offline for 30+ days, their local credentials expire and sync refuses to resume. Don't make them wipe the device — all their unsynced field data lives there! Instead, open the support console, pick "Offline Reinstate," and enter their handle. The console will ask for the support team's shared recovery passphrase before issuing a reinstatement token. Use the one below.

unlock words, bagaf-fajeg: zorael-kelax-fraath-quenix-eliok-sileth-aldmir-wenir-druiel